
Argent has unveiled plans for its Thomas Heatherwick-designed retail revival of the Coal Drops buildings in the heart of its 67-acre King’s Cross regeneration, N1C.
Argent hopes the project will establish the area as a retail destination with close to 100,000 sq ft of shops, restaurants, bars and events space.
Plans will be submitted to Camden council imminently.
The Coal Drops Yard buildings were originally built in the 1850s to receive freight arriving from the North of England by train and were later used for warehousing and light industry.
